Workshop program

This year edition of the workshop will take place entirely on line for all presenters (and open to live attendants), in four sessions on the 21st of March. The presentations will be carried on by the presenting authors via Whova.

Time for live interaction and discussion will be provided during the meetings. Each talk will include a 15 minutes presentation and 5 minutes of discussion.

The presentation times have been chosen trying to take into account all presenters time zones.
